On Tuesday, February 28th, Bishop Talley of the Diocese of Memphis presided at the Mass for the Institution of Lectors. The Rite of Institution of Lectors is one of the ministries a seminarian must receive before ordination to the Diaconate and Priesthood. Those given the ministry of Lector are entrusted with reading the Sacred Scriptures during Mass and the Liturgy of the Hours. Each seminarian receiving the ministry of Lector were instructed by Bishop Talley, “Take this book of Holy Scripture and be faithful in handing on the Word of God, so that it may grow strong in the hearts of his people.” The new lectors will now proclaim the readings of Sacred Scripture at Mass for the community.
